Browse Source

将snowboy唤醒节点添加到/voice_system命名空间下,可以与话题命名空间相同

corvin 5 years ago
parent
commit
8bad81adb6
1 changed files with 3 additions and 2 deletions
  1. 3 2
      catkin_ws/src/snowboy_wakeup/launch/snowboy_wakeup.launch

+ 3 - 2
catkin_ws/src/snowboy_wakeup/launch/snowboy_wakeup.launch

@@ -1,8 +1,9 @@
 <launch>
     <arg name="ASR_Topic" default="/voice_system/asr_topic" />
     <arg name="AUDIO_Topic" default="/voice_system/audio_data" />
+    <arg name="namespace" default="voice_system" />
 
-    <node name="audio_capture" pkg="audio_capture" type="audio_capture" output="screen" required="true">
+    <node ns="$(arg namespace)" name="audio_capture" pkg="audio_capture" type="audio_capture" output="screen" required="true">
         <param name="format" value="wave" />
         <param name="channels" value="1" />
         <param name="depth" value="16" />
@@ -11,7 +12,7 @@
         <remap from="audio" to="$(arg AUDIO_Topic)" />
     </node>
 
-    <node pkg="snowboy_wakeup" type="hotword_detector_node" name="snowboy_wakeup" respawn="true">
+    <node ns="$(arg namespace)" pkg="snowboy_wakeup" type="hotword_detector_node" name="snowboy_wakeup" respawn="true">
         <param name="resource_filename" value="$(find snowboy_wakeup)/resources/common.res" />
         <param name="model_filename" value="$(find snowboy_wakeup)/resources/snowboy.umdl" />
         <param name="beep_filename" value="$(find snowboy_wakeup)/resources/ding.wav" />